12 Questions to Ask Your Doctor:
1. Do you believe DCIS is “cancer,””pre-cancer” or “a risk for future invasive cancer?”
2. On pathology report: Can you please explain my grade of DCIS, ER/PR status, and if there are any other points of concern?
3. Are there ways to determine my individual risk for future invasive cancer?
4. What is your opinion on DCISionRT bio-marker test? Can you order this test for me?
5. What is your opinion of the COMET study and active monitoring trials for low-risk DCIS?
6. Are there any resources you recommend for learning more about DCIS and/or offering peer support?
7. Are there any diet and lifestyle recommendations for women diagnosed with DCIS to reduce risk of future invasive cancer?
8. If I was interested in monitoring my DCIS, would you be willing to oversee my care?
9. I have concerns about too many mammograms and MRI’s. What are my options for monitoring DCIS long-term?
10. Do you have any patients who have been monitoring DCIS and incorporating healthy diet & lifestyle changes?
11. Do you have knowledge on alternatives to hormone-blocking medication?
12. What studies do you recommend I review?
